What Is Photonics

Photonics is a rapidly growing field that has revolutionized the way we interact with and understand light. In simple terms, photonics is the science and technology of generating, controlling, and detecting photons, which are the fundamental particles of light. This field encompasses a wide range of applications, from telecommunications and information technology to healthcare and manufacturing.

One of the key advantages of photonics is its ability to transmit information at incredibly high speeds. This is why photonics is so crucial in the telecommunications industry, where it is used to transmit data through optical fibers. These fibers are capable of carrying vast amounts of information over long distances with minimal loss of signal strength. This is in stark contrast to traditional copper wires, which are limited in the amount of data they can carry and are prone to interference.

In the manufacturing industry, photonics is used in laser cutting, welding, and 3D printing. These technologies allow for the precise manipulation of materials, leading to greater efficiency and cost savings. Photonics is also being used in the development of new materials and devices, such as solar cells and LEDs, which have the potential to revolutionize the way we generate and use energy.
